Long time resident of Meadow Lake, SK; Tania passed away peacefully on December 2nd, 2025, in Valleyview, AB with her family by her side.
We were blessed with the rare gift of celebrating Tania’s 95th birthday together in September. A milestone memory.
At age 7 Tania immigrated to Canada from Syczewo, Poland. She was raised by her parents Emilian& Paraskiewa Shkopich in a family of seven with four brothers. Tania learned early the values of hard work, strength, faith, and loyalty-qualities she carried throughout her entire life.
She met the love of her life, Lorne Chapman and married in 1956. Together they built a beautiful, love-filled life. They raised three children-Gregg, Lynn and Janice.
Tania’s heart expanded even more with the arrival of her grandchildren: Seth, Heidi, Riley, and Patricia, each of whom she cherished deeply. Her great-grandchildren-Mckinley, Nora, and Emma-were her pride and joy. They represented the legacy of her maternal line, a lineage she nurtured with endless time, affection and wisdom. We are so thankful for the time the girls had with their great grandmother, all the pictures, videos and memories will be forever cherished.
A woman of many passions, Tania found joy in gardening, canning, berry picking, fishing, volunteering, and nurturing others through acts of quiet service. Her faith in God was a steady thread throughout her life, influencing the way she loved, forgave, and supported those around her. Tania had a gift for teaching others what unconditional love truly looked like-steady, patient, and without expectation.
Her life was one of service: to her family, her community, and her faith. Those who were lucky enough to know her will remember her generous heart, and the gentle strength in which she carried those she loved.
Her one of a kind vernaky, holubtsi and dill pickles will always be remembered. She took great pride in her immaculate yard and spent countless hours ensuring it was exactly that. She loved to laugh and always had time to sit and chat with all who dropped in.
Tania leaves behind a family who will forever carry her lessons, her love, and her spirit in their hearts. Her legacy lives on in the generations she nurtured, the traditions she passed down, and the countless lives she touched.
